Study design

Details on test conditions:
Sensitiser (for indirect photolysis): OH
Sensitiser concentration: 1000000 molecule/cm³

Results and discussion

Any other information on results incl. tables

Rate constant (for indirect photolysis):  0.00000000000022 cm³/(molecule*sec)
Degradation in % (for indirect photolysis):  50  after 35.6 day(s)
